**Action Item 4: Harden Brambler's deletion guard.** The stale-branch cleanup bot deleted two branches that had open review threads because it only checked merged status, not active discussions. Add a pre-deletion check against the review API and require a dry-run report for any batch over ten branches. The proposed guard logic and rollout plan are written up on the internal design page.

operations page: https://confluence.tolvaqsys.corp/spaces/pages/pages/6e787158f507

Finance Review Summary — Brindlecore Plus Tier

To heads of department: the new Brindlecore Plus subscription tier launched on schedule. Uptake at 6% of active base, above forecast. ARPU up 11%; churn flat. Support costs slightly elevated due to onboarding queries. Margin impact positive from month two. Pricing holds through Q3; no discounting authorised. Full model refresh due next cycle. Direction for the tier's expansion is set out in the note below.

internal memo for yaduf-fahap: The board signed off on a budget of $4.5 million for Project Ralix. The renewal with Eliokox Freight closes at $63.8 million a year, 9 percent below the last contract.

This release addresses the long GC pauses in the Corridane matching service observed during peak pairing windows. We moved the candidate cache off-heap and capped tenured-generation growth, cutting p99 pause time from 1.4 s to 90 ms in the Welbourne load rig. As part of this release we also rotated the artifact signing key, since the previous one exceeded its policy lifetime. Reviewers should verify new builds against the rotated key only; older signatures remain valid until end of quarter. The new signing key is below.

deploy key for kajof-yawif: bky9_fvxrpdHPq